### Gentlemen's Apparel Forecast: 2025 Styles


Anticipate a significant change in menswear for 2025, influenced by a blend of utilitarian practicality and expressive individuality. Looser silhouettes, mainly in outerwear like maverick jackets and overshirts, will stay trending. We’re further predicting a resurgence of bespoke clothing, but with a more casual approach; think unstructured blazers paired with substantial knitwear. Color palettes will favor towards organic tones like forest green, fired orange, and deep blues, complemented by surprising pops of electric yellow or magenta. Footwear will fashion men boots experience a increasing demand for traditional styles – imagine sturdy boots and minimalist leather trainers. Finally, eco-friendly materials including responsible production techniques will stay paramount to the contemporary man’s closet.

Navigating Men's Wardrobe for All Age

Dressing well isn't about chasing fleeting looks; it's about understanding what flatters your shape and reflects your demeanor at each stage of existence. Younger men, in their late teens and twenties, can explore bolder hues and more experimental silhouettes, perhaps leaning into streetwear or smart-casual aesthetics. As you enter your thirties and forties, a shift towards a more refined and considered way often feels natural – think quality fabrics, timeless pieces, and a focus on fit. Consider incorporating classic items like a well-tailored blazer, chinos, and versatile sweaters. For men over fifty, embracing a sophisticated and comfortable aesthetic is key; opting for muted tones, well-fitting garments, and prioritizing ease of movement while maintaining a polished appearance. Ultimately, the best approach is to cultivate a personal feeling of style that evolves with you, always reflecting confidence and individual personality.

Next Men's Style

Prepare for a shift in men's apparel as we head into 2025. The overarching theme is relaxed sophistication, blending comfort with considered details. Think elevated workwear – robust knits layered over durable pants, perhaps in a earthy palette of olive, charcoal, and deep blues. Structured garments aren't disappearing, but they're becoming softer, with wider legs and relaxed silhouettes. Expect to see a resurgence of the 1970s – a subtle nod, not a full-blown throwback – with wide-leg denim and suede jackets. Essentials for the discerning man will include a versatile, well-made overshirt, a pair of comfortable yet stylish sneakers, and a classic, broken-in leather messenger bag. Furthermore, functional garments that offer both warmth and style, like quilted vests and bomber jackets, will remain key. Don't be afraid to experiment with texture – corduroy will find its place alongside traditional denim and cotton. The focus is on classic pieces that can be mixed and matched to create a look that is both personal and polished. Ultimately, 2025 promises a innovative take on men's fashion.
